Understanding the Core Structure of the Wip Goods Menu
The foundational design of the Wip Goods Menu focuses on clarity and ease of use, enabling quick access to a wide array of products. At its core, the menu is structured around hierarchical categories that ensure logical grouping of goods.
Each category within the menu can be expanded or collapsed, allowing users to drill down into subcategories or specific product listings without overwhelming the interface. This hierarchical design not only improves navigation but also supports scalability, accommodating inventories of varying sizes.
Moreover, the menu integrates sorting and filtering options that empower users to locate items efficiently. Filters can be based on attributes such as price range, availability, or product specifications, making the search process highly tailored and time-saving.
Key Components of the Menu Structure
- Categories and Subcategories: Logical grouping of goods for organized browsing.
- Search Functionality: A powerful tool to quickly find specific items.
- Filter Options: Enable refined searches based on multiple criteria.
- Real-Time Updates: Ensures inventory status is current and accurate.

Integration Capabilities With Other Systems
The Wip Goods Menu is designed to operate seamlessly within larger organizational ecosystems. Its ability to integrate with ERP, CRM, and e-commerce platforms ensures that data flows smoothly across different departments and functions.
This interoperability reduces manual data entry, minimizes errors, and enhances overall operational efficiency. APIs (Application Programming Interfaces) facilitate this integration, allowing businesses to synchronize inventory levels, pricing, and customer information in real time.
Such connectivity also supports advanced analytics, enabling companies to derive actionable insights from sales trends and customer preferences.
Integration Benefits
- Streamlined Operations: Automated data exchange between systems.
- Improved Accuracy: Reduction in manual errors and inconsistencies.
- Enhanced Reporting: Consolidated data for comprehensive analysis.
- Scalability: Supports business growth with adaptable integrations.

Security and Data Protection in the Wip Goods Menu
Protecting sensitive inventory and transactional data is paramount in any goods management system. The Wip Goods Menu incorporates multiple layers of security to safeguard information against unauthorized access and breaches.
Role-based access control ensures that users can only view or modify data pertinent to their responsibilities. In addition, encryption protocols protect data both in transit and at rest.
Regular audits and compliance with data protection regulations such as GDPR help maintain system integrity and build customer trust.
Security Features
- Role-Based Access Control (RBAC): Restricts permissions based on user roles.
- Data Encryption: Ensures confidentiality of sensitive information.
- Audit Trails: Tracks all changes and access for accountability.
- Compliance: Adherence to industry and legal standards.
